State-of-the-Art Facilities

The Center for Caring with Technology, a clinical simulation lab, is an 8,300 square foot space that includes an array of learning spaces: two health assessment and adult medical-surgical labs; an obstetrical, newborn, and pediatric lab with a home health component, and two examination rooms. The Center is equipped with a state-of-the-art audio/visual capture system.

Simulation Labs

Our simulation laboratories foster varied and intensive simulations in all programs across the curriculum. The Center for Caring with Technology is used extensively in the Entry-Level BSN program. Simulations provide a realistic and risk-free environment for students to practice nursing skills and develop clinical reasoning. 

The Center also fills an essential role in meeting the urgent demand for more nurse educators by supporting graduate courses in the MSN program, Leadership in Nursing Education concentration.
